When Sleep Becomes A Luxury

Those four weeks with my parents flew by in no time. Ever since they left on Sunday, Yifan and I have been really really busy with Skylar. To say that things are bad is an understatement.

For one, Skylar hardly ever sleeps. Not at night, and not much in the day too. He cries and screams a lot, even when it is not near feeding time, and wants to be carried all the time. Needless to say, I am exhausted, and am on the verge of falling really sick. I had a terrible headache yesterday ( and I hardly ever get headaches) that Yifan had to sleep with Skylar in the living room, so I could get more rest.

The baby has been a lot more restless and fussy too, and I suspect he may have colic. He screams his head off at night, and nothing we do can pacify him. Then there is also the problem of gas. He spits up every now and then, and on a couple of occasions, even vomited a little. The doctor thinks he is having indigestion, and hopefully the Mylicon Drops will help him.

It is tough. We feel helpless when he cries, but the minute we see him smile, we know that everything we are going through right now is worth it. The next few months are going to be trying, but I tell myself that things will get better. It has to. Right?

Oh, and yesterday was the start of many " First" for Skylar -- he finally has tears!!
